I am attempting to paint my shed. I mistakenly used Rustins Knotting solution to cover all the knots, and then read on the bottle that I should not use it with water based paints! Stupid me for not reading the instructions first.

How can I recover from this? I have tried sanding down the knots, but it is quite hard and resin seems to gunk up the sanding paper. I am also not sure how much I need to sand these patches down.

Or do I just give up on the water based paint and use something else?


 
Sand.
Aluminium primer. Stir it well.
Give it a week to cure.
Crack on with painting.
